A construction consultant is someone that oversees a construction project. They are often overlooked when undertaking small home projects or building your own home.

But, they can be invaluable in generating a successful completion of the project.

image - Top 4 Reasons Why You Need to Hire A Construction Consultant for Your Project
Top 4 Reasons Why You Need to Hire A Construction Consultant for Your Project

The simple fact is that building your own home is complicated, as is any sizeable project.

You’ll have to deal with the architect, have comprehensive plans drawn up, probably get planning permission, and then look at hiring the various contractors.

That means electricians, plumbers, and builders.

It’s complicated, time-consuming, and needs to be constantly supervised. Unless you have a lot of experience supervising people and plenty of time on your hands, you’re not going to be able to do the role justice.

If you’re not supervising properly then corners will be cut and your finished project may not look like you want it to.

That’s when you’ll wish you’d hired a reputable building consultant Sydney to handle it all for you. There are 4 great reasons why you need a construction consultant:

1. Quality of Work

If you don’t have a lot of experience with the building then it’s very easy for a builder to pull the wool over your eyes.

In effect, they swap products and use ones that look the same but aren’t as good. This will increase their profit margins. They are also likely to cut corners where they think you won’t notice.

However, an expert construction consultant will supervise every step of the project and ensure everything is done according to the agreements, which means you get the house you’re paying for.

2. Timely Delivery

There are many reasons why a project can fall behind schedule but one that is easily avoided is builders not turning up because no one is supervising or they think they can handle another project at the same time.

Your construction consultant will monitor them, ensure they are staying on schedule, and even make sure there is a completion penalty if they fail to complete on time.

They’ll make sure the project is finished when you expect it to be.

3. Knowledge

Construction consultants have a lot of knowledge and experience managing projects and dealing with the unexpected.

The truth is that most projects ht a road bump when something unexpected occurs. Your construction consultant will be able to evaluate the issue and find the best solution without lowering quality or the finish date.

That saves you the stress of worrying about everything.

4. Budgeting

Finally, the construction consultant will know the budget you have and how it is being allocated. They will ensure everyone sticks to the budget or work out ways to re-allocate the budget if necessary.

This means being good with all the facts and figures.

In short, the building consultant is going to make sure you have your project finished on time with a minimal amount of stress.

They handle everything and report directly to you, allowing you to monitor progress and continue enjoying life.
